I have priced out gym equipment, because I live 100 miles from the nearest “city” (…which is, like 20,000 people).
At $30/mo for a gym membership, it would take me >15 years to pay for a decent, mid-range power rack, Olympic bars, and bench. And that’s not including the weights themselves, which are usually $2-5/pound. A decent elliptical machine from eBay? Another 2 years, plus a year and a half for shipping.
If you’re serious about weights, and not independently wealthy, it almost always makes more sense to have a gym membership.
